Kitchen window remodeling services involve updating or replacing existing windows to improve the overall look, functionality, and energy efficiency of a kitchen space. This process can include installing new window styles, upgrading to more modern materials, or enlarging existing openings to allow more natural light and better ventilation. Skilled service providers ensure the installation is seamless, helping homeowners achieve a refreshed appearance and a more comfortable environment within their kitchens. Whether it's a small upgrade or a complete overhaul, these services are designed to enhance the usability and aesthetic appeal of the kitchen area.
This type of remodeling can help address several common problems faced by homeowners. Outdated or damaged windows can lead to drafts, increased energy bills, and difficulty maintaining a comfortable temperature inside the home. Poorly insulated or cracked windows may also contribute to noise issues or allow moisture to seep in, potentially causing damage over time. Kitchen window remodeling can solve these issues by replacing old windows with energy-efficient options, sealing gaps, and improving insulation. These upgrades not only make the kitchen more pleasant to use but can also reduce ongoing maintenance and repair needs.

The overview below groups typical Kitchen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Monroe,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s or replacements in kitchens gener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on window size and materials.
Standard Replacement - Replacing an entire kitchen window with a standard model us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more custom projects tend to push costs higher, especially with premium materials or additional features.
Full Kitchen Window Remodel - Complete remodeling of multiple kitchen windows can range from $4,000 to over $8,000 depending on the number of windows and complexity of the design. Many projects in this category are at the higher end, especially with custom framing or specialty glass.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more complex window installations or custom designs can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ve high-end materials, special features, or extensive structural work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
